Abstract:
Fresh healthy human erythrocytes were treated by four kinds of bile acid solution (DOC, GDC, C-Na and GC-Na) at physiological and pathological concentrations of human serum level. The more hydrophobic bile acids (DOC and GDC) significantly affected lipid components of erythrocyte. membranes and morphology at concentration of 0.5 mmol/L and 1.0 mmol/L. To the extent of he-molysis DOC and GDC were more hemolytic than C-Na and GC-Na. Additionally the erthrocytes from patients with biliary obstruction were also studied. The results suggest that the more hydropho-bicity of bile acid, the more erythrocyte damage. The hydrophobicity was associated with the structure of bile acid molecules.
